Quick summary
The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) has issued a Master Circular for compliance with the provisions of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015 by listed entities. This circular consolidates all relevant circulars issued till December 30, 2025.
Who is affected
The provisions of this Master Circular are applicable to:
- Listed entities that have listed their specified securities.
- Other stakeholders, including Statutory Auditors, Depository Participants, Registrar and Transfer Agents, Material Subsidiaries of listed entities, e-voting service providers, and certain industry associations.
What changes
The Master Circular updates and consolidates various circulars related to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ements (LODR) Regulations. It rescinds previous circulars to the extent they relate to compliance with the LODR Regulations but does not affect actions taken or penalties incurred under the rescinded circulars.
Action items
- Listed entities, recognized stock exchanges, depositories, and other stakeholders must comply with the provisions of this circular to the extent applicable.
- Recognized Stock Exchanges and Depositories are directed to bring the contents of this circular to the notice of all stakeholders and put in place necessary systems and infrastructure for monitoring and implementation.
Key dates-deadlines
- The Master Circular was issued on July 11, 2023, and last updated on January 30, 2026.
